Stable structures of complexes formed by the interaction of [PtCl 3 (Eug)] ‐ with either 5,7‐dichloro‐8‐hydroxyquinoline or 5‐nitro‐8‐hydroxyquinoline are determined and compared to the experimental results. Interaction energies and variation of Gibbs free energies, AIM and MEP analysis are carried out at B3LYP/LanL2DZ level of theory to explore characteristics of the complexes and the Pt∙∙∙X (X = N, O) contacts. The obtained results show that charge‐transfer interaction plays a significant role in stabilizing of the examined complexes. It is remarkable that the calculated IR spectra of the examined complexes are well matched with those of the experimental results.
